MGM #1 minutes

Event Minutes posted by Bobby Shen on February 13, 2013

MGM #1 minutes

Event: 
MGM #1 - First meeting for 2013!

We had an excellent turnout last night at AFH AKL's first meeting for a year! 14 people came along, many fresh faces and keen to get into some social architecture! Meetings will be first Wednesday of every month, same place, same time.

The majority of posts and opportunities will be put up on the Chapter Network, rather than emailed, so join as a member of Auckland Chapter now.

What:          AFH MGM #1
When:         Wednesday 13 February, 6.00pm - 7.30pm
Where:        Jasmax, 2 Marston Street, Parnell, Auckland.

MINUTES

1 General Updates

  1. Christchruch: Josh joined us from Christchurch and told us a bit about the work that's been happening there. (Creative Quarter, Gap Filler, etc)

2 Projects

  1. HELP Auckland (Bobby)
    Ongoing building alteration, currently awaiting client feedback.
    Waiting on earthquake reports and Bobby to touch base with Gary Lawson. Team meeting next Monday and if any more people required, will post on Chapter Network.
  2. Winton opportunity (Darren) - Darren informed us that due to lack of funding it will probably be a while before anything happens (building extension and building a play fort). Suggested that we ask Darren if he would like us to assemble a team of people who could do some drawings - may help with garnering support and funding.
  3. Possible Napier project (Andy) - Andy's entry to the AFH UNrestricted Access Challenge last year was a finalist entry. Napier City Council is interested in having this project built but planning and heritage issues that may take a while to resolve. A team could do some prelim work (planning issues, formalise design, prepare drawings for planner/council consumption). Heather suggested Salmond Reed, who work with a lot of heritage architecture) might assist. Ellen has worked in Council for some time, so could help. Opportunity will be posted on Chapter Network to sign up soon.
    To see Andy's entry: http://openarchitecturenetwork.org/node/12262
  4. Glulam opportunity (Bobby) - First meeting on Tuesday, information session. Highlighted that it would be best to check the useability of the material before allocating to community groups.
  5. Mangere East (Bobby) - idling project, community leader will contact us re further progress.
  6. Guerilla Playspaces (Alex) - guerrilla-style interactive play spaces for people of all ages including children, to make our Auckland CBD more family friendly and fun. Has parallels with our work with Space Invaders. Alex will keep us in the loop about this and any opportunities.

2 Initiatives

  1. Members Drive - at UoA, Unitec and AUT. Please let us know if you want to help.
  2. Round the Bays - 10th March, annual social event. Many are keen, email bobby@afh-auckland.org to join us!
  3. Architecture+Women and Auckland Architecture Week - we may be able to take part in this somehow. Will keen in touch about projects/involvement with Megan Rule.
  4. YIMFY - Yes In My Front Yard! Sustainable building technologies initiative. Contact yimfynz@gmail.com for more info.
  5. Warrior Dash (Lorraine + Jen) - 6th April - running through mud and muck to get us away from our CAD computers http://www.warriordash.com/

3 Miscellaneous

  1. Andy's trip photos to Venice Biennale and the AFH exhibition there to be shown at next MGM.
